CU BuffZone: Though it was a challenge the University of Colorado expected to handle, a significant hurdle that potentially could have thwarted the Buffaloes’ football opener has been cleared.
On Thursday, CU announced that Boulder County Public Health has approved the university’s game day protocols for COVID-19 mitigation during the Buffs’ opener Nov. 7 against UCLA (5 p.m., ESPN2).
